libxl: run libxl__arch_domain_create() much earlier.
Among other things, arch_domain_create() sets the shadow(/hap/p2m) memory allocation, which must happen after vcpus are assigned (or the shadow op will fail) but before memory is allocated (or we might run out of p2m memory). libxl__build_pre(), which already sets similar things like maxmem, semes like a reasonable spot for it. That needed a bit of plumbing to get the right datastructure from the caller. As a side-effect, the return code from libxl__arch_domain_create() is no longer ignored.
